

Born in Bryan, Texas to Linda (Restivo) Cash and Leon Frank Cash, Sr., Leon grew up in the warmth and care of the Cash/Restivo/Varisco families.
At an early age, his lifelong love of the cattle business and country living began by helping his father on their Brazos bottom farm and at the Caldwell Livestock Auction Barn. He graduated from Bryan High School (’81) during which he was active in the Future Farmers of America and worked at Cash Grocery on the weekends. He then attended Texas A&M University where he graduated with a bachelor’s degree in Agricultural Economics in 1985.
Leon embodied the values of hard work and integrity throughout his career as a cattle rancher. He was a lifelong member of St. Anthony’s Catholic Church and had a deep devotion to his faith and God’s promises of Eternal Life.
Leon was also known for his remarkable personality and humor. He never met a stranger and enjoyed countless conversations with his good friends and family. He was an avid football fan especially of Texas A&M and the Dallas Cowboys.
Leon remains a blessing to all who knew him. His devotion to his family will leave a lasting impact. In Christ, he is made whole, free from pain, and now running cattle on the greenest pastures one could imagine.
Leon was preceded in death by his father, Leon, Sr.; his grandparents, Frank and Lucille (Nigliazzo) Restivo, Frank and Palma (Varisco) Cash; his aunt and uncle, Bobby and Palma (Cash) Holiday; and his uncle, Jim Bennett.
Leon is survived by his devoted mother, Linda; his sisters, Jean (Cash) Van Wyckhouse and John, Pam (Cash) Murphy and Paul; his nephews, Cash Murphy and fiance Madison Maroney, Jack Murphy; his niece, Jenna Van Wyckhouse; his uncle, Frank Cash and Luci; his aunts, Jane (Restivo) Bennett and Betty (Restivo) Kirkpatrick; and many cherished cousins.
